云服务器网:购买云服务器和VPS必上的网站!

python for循环和while循环的简单示例

Python中的循环是编程中非常重要的概念。循环允许您多次执行相同的代码块,直到满足特定条件为止。在Pytho…

Python中的循环是编程中非常重要的概念。循环允许您多次执行相同的代码块,直到满足特定条件为止。在Python中,有几种类型的循环可供选择,包括for循环和while循环。本文将重点介绍Python中的循环以及如何使用它们来实现各种编程任务。

python for循环示例:

在Python中,for循环用于遍历可迭代对象(如列表、元组或字符串)中的元素。下面是一个使用for循环打印列表中元素的简单示例:

fruits = [“apple”, “banana”, “cherry”]

for fruit in fruits:

print(fruit)

上述代码将依次打印出列表中的每个水果名称。

除了遍历列表,for循环还可以与range函数一起使用来生成一系列数字。例如,下面的代码将打印从1到5的数字:

for i in range(1, 6):

print(i)

在这个例子中,range函数生成一个从1到5的数字序列,并依次将每个数字赋值给变量i,然后打印出该数字。

python while循环示例:

另一种常见的循环类型是while循环。while循环在给定条件为真时执行代码块,直到条件为假为止。下面是一个使用while循环计算1到5的数字之和的示例:

sum = 0

i = 1

while i <= 5:

sum += i

i += 1

print(sum)

在上述代码中,我们使用变量sum来存储数字之和,变量i用于迭代每个数字。while循环将检查条件i <= 5是否为真,如果为真,则执行循环体中的代码,将当前数字添加到sum中,并将i的值增加1,直到i的值超过5为止。

Python控制循环行为的关键字:

除了简单的循环,Python还提供了一些用于控制循环行为的关键字。例如,您可以使用break语句来提前结束循环,或者使用continue语句跳过当前迭代并继续下一次迭代。下面是一个示例,演示如何使用这些关键字:

fruits = [“apple”, “banana”, “cherry”]

for fruit in fruits:

if fruit == “banana”:

continue

if fruit == “cherry”:

break

print(fruit)

在上述代码中,当循环遍历到水果名称为”banana”时,continue语句将跳过当前迭代,并继续下一次迭代。当循环遍历到水果名称为”cherry”时,break语句将提前结束循环。

总结一下,Python中的循环是一种强大的编程工具,可用于重复执行相同的代码块。无论是for循环还是while循环,它们都可以帮助您更有效地解决各种编程问题。请记住,在使用循环时,要确保条件正确设置,以避免无限循环。如果您对循环的使用有任何疑问,请查阅官方文档或参考可靠的在线资源,以获取更多信息和示例。

本文来源:https://www.yuntue.com/post/51890.html | 云服务器网,转载请注明出处!

关于作者: yuntue

云服务器(www.yuntue.com)是一家专门做阿里云服务器代金券、腾讯云服务器优惠券的网站,这里你可以找到阿里云服务器腾讯云服务器等国内主流云服务器优惠价格,以及海外云服务器、vps主机等优惠信息,我们会为你提供性价比最高的云服务器和域名、数据库、CDN、免费邮箱等企业常用互联网资源。

为您推荐

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注